Deal Pipe® presents a long-standing SaaS Company at the forefront of web-based Report Management, unifying publishing, scheduling, distribution, and secure access control for leading reporting tools (Crystal Reports, SSRS, and Power BI). Established in 2003, this platform has delivered 22 years of dependable performance across finance, government, healthcare, retail, manufacturing, education, and logistics, offering a cost-effective, administrator-friendly solution that streamlines how organizations deliver the right information to the right users at the right time.

Business Model

The company sells perpetual licenses with annual maintenance alongside project-based consulting, creating a balanced mix of upfront and recurring revenue. Approximately 1,000 active clients are under management with an average contract of about $3,000, and there is no material seasonality. Retention is exceptional: many accounts have renewed maintenance for well over a decade, supporting stable cash flows and low churn. The platform’s core value proposition is consolidation—one distribution layer that supports Crystal, SSRS, and Power BI—reducing licensing overhead, simplifying external delivery, and removing technical friction in complex, multi-tool environments.

Operations

The business operates with minimal overhead and working capital requirements, primarily salaries. A single operator currently manages day-to-day responsibilities in roughly 10–20 hours per week, supported by a well-established release cadence and responsive maintenance program that keeps the platform current and secure. Customers range from small regional entities to multi-billion-dollar enterprises across North America, Europe, and Asia, and the company is not dependent on any single account.

Growth Opportunities

Significant upside exists in the Power BI segment, where the platform’s approach to user management and external sharing can materially reduce total cost of ownership—often requiring only a single Pro license for distribution while simplifying access for outside stakeholders. A buyer can accelerate expansion by packaging cloud-hosted offerings, formalizing outbound and partner channels (BI implementers/MSPs), launching targeted search campaigns around report scheduling and distribution use cases, and converting select consulting engagements into higher-margin recurring service tiers.
